Aurora Serverless can now add roughly 12 ACUs in the first second of a scale-up event on platform versions 3 and 4. The change is automatic and is most useful for bursty SaaS, API, batch and agent workloads, but it does not remove the separate resume delay when a database has scaled all the way to zero.

Jev’s launch claims were interesting; Vercel’s usage data is more useful. Nearly 13% of paid AI Gateway teams tried the typed decision model in its first day, while Jev also rose to a material share of gateway requests. That does not establish retention or production success, but it is unusually fast developer uptake for a model designed to make bounded software decisions rather than generate prose.

Google has moved the Smart Campaign API creation cutoff to September 23. New create operations will fail, while existing campaigns can still be updated and served; Google points developers toward Performance Max, Search or Demand Gen for new automation.
A new npm granular-token scope lets CI stage package versions without permission to publish them, extending npm’s broader move toward least-privilege publishing after its install-script, trusted-publishing and malware-gate changes.
